The XPeng G6
The XPeng G6 is a mid-sized electric SUV designed to compete with models like the Tesla Model Y. This SUV is available in two variants:
- 580 Pro: Equipped with a battery that provides a range of up to 580 km (WLTP). Prices start from RM 165,000.
- 755 Pro: Equipped with a battery that provides a range of up to 755 km (WLTP). Prices start from RM 185,000.
Both variants are more affordable compared to the Tesla Model Y, which starts at RM 191,000.
XPeng X9
The XPeng X9 is a seven-seater electric MPV offering three variants:
- Standard Range 2WD Pro: Powered by a single electric motor producing 315 hp and 450 Nm of torque. It comes with an 84.5 kWh LFP battery, offering a range of up to 500 km (WLTP). Prices start from RM 269,888.
- Long Range 2WD Pro: The same motor specifications as the Standard variant but with a 101.5 kWh NMC battery, offering a range of up to 590 km (WLTP). Prices start from RM 287,888.
- Long Range 2WD Pro Plus: Identical to the Long Range 2WD Pro but with additional premium features such as Zero Gravity seats upholstered in Nappa leather. Prices start from RM 299,888.
All XPeng X9 variants support DC fast charging up to 317 kW, allowing the battery to charge from 10% to 80% in just 20 minutes.

Exterior and Interior of X9
The XPeng X9 boasts a futuristic design with sharp lines and a large panoramic sunroof. The front fascia includes slim LED headlights and a bold grille. Inside, the X9 offers a luxurious cabin with a digital dashboard, a large central touchscreen, and ventilated leather seats. The seven-seat configuration provides ample space, while features like massaging front seats and advanced climate control enhance passenger comfort.
